Transaction 166d0603370523554ced7a185c5344782bb4a71e50c407165a51c1cb055ee515

1 Input
2 Outputs
  • 166d0603370523554ced7a185c5344782bb4a71e50c407165a51c1cb055ee515:0
  • value  23756757
    address  1AQ3Kg65yy1qdLWcyYh6npo2bgKyW8kzfG
  • 166d0603370523554ced7a185c5344782bb4a71e50c407165a51c1cb055ee515:1
  • value  16962990
    address  1Mcpzpxbez2iuC36p6VKxDMmp7MF5x3js6